What are you supporting?

Island Senior Resources is the largest non-profit in Island County supporting older adults, the disabled, and their caregivers through variety of programs. 

Your support at the benefit dinner goes towards our excellent programs including Meals on Wheels program, which delivered over 102,000 meals to older adults and disabled people in Island County last year. Our community need for Meals on Wheels continues to grow as federal funding is at risk of being cut. Our two fundraising events, the benefit dinner and benefit golf tournament, are being held to raise awareness and donations for this worthwhile cause.
